Method 1: Resetting with an Admin Account
If you have an admin account on your Mac, you can easily reset the password by following these steps:
1. Restart your Mac and hold down the Command + R keys immediately after hearing the startup sound.
2. This will boot your Mac into Recovery Mode.
3. Once in Recovery Mode, select the language and click on the “Utilities” menu at the top of the screen.
4. From the Utilities menu, choose “Terminal.”
5. In the Terminal window, type the following command: `resetpassword`.
6. Press Enter, and you will be prompted to choose the disk on which your user account is stored.
7. Select the disk and press Enter.
8. Next, you will be asked to choose the user account whose password you want to reset.
9. Select the user account and press Enter.
10. Now, you can set a new password for the user account. Make sure to choose a strong password to enhance security.
11. Once you have set the new password, press Enter.
12. Restart your Mac and log in with the new password.
Method 2: Resetting with a Bootable Installer
If you don’t have an admin account or if the first method doesn’t work for you, you can try using a bootable installer to reset your Mac password:
1. Download a bootable installer for macOS from a trusted source.
2. Create a bootable installer using a USB drive or external hard drive.
3. Restart your Mac and hold down the Option key immediately after hearing the startup sound.
4. From the startup options, select the bootable installer you created.
5. Once the installer loads, go to the “Utilities” menu and choose “Terminal.”
6. In the Terminal window, type the following command: `resetpassword`.
7. Press Enter, and you will be prompted to choose the disk on which your user account is stored.
8. Select the disk and press Enter.
9. Follow the same steps as in Method 1 to set a new password for your user account.
10. Restart your Mac and log in with the new password.
